Florida Relaunches Program to Help Frontline Workers Buy Their First Home
Good news for Florida's frontline workers: a popular homebuying assistance program is back.
The Florida Hometown Heroes Program has relaunched, offering up to $35,000 to help certain workers cover down payment and closing costs when purchasing their first home.
Who Can Apply?
The program is designed for full-time employees who work for Florida-based employers in specific frontline fields, including:
- Law enforcement officers
- Firefighters
- Educators
- Healthcare workers
- Childcare employees
- Active-duty military members
- National Guard and Reserve members
- Veterans (who are also employed full-time by a Florida employer)
How Does the Assistance Work?
The money is provided as a loan with zero percent interest. You don't have to make payments on it until you either sell the home or finish paying off your main mortgage.
Act Fast — Funding Is Limited
The Florida legislature set aside $50 million for the program this year, but experts say it won't last long. Deidre Graybill, president-elect of the Orlando Regional Realtor Association, expects most of the money to run out within 30 days.
Graybill has seen how much the program helps families.
"It's delightful because there's so much money needed just to move, just to pay for movers, just to pack," she said. "Having that extra resource makes the transition into your home a lot easier."
She strongly recommends working with a real estate agent who has experience with the program.
"This is something you have to prepare for. It helps to work alongside a professional who understands the guidelines," Graybill explained.
Other Requirements to Qualify
- You must be buying a primary residence in Florida and move in within 60 days of closing.
- You must work at or report to a physical Florida location. Fully remote workers do not qualify. Hybrid workers must be on-site at least three days per week.
- You must generally be a first-time homebuyer, meaning you haven't owned a primary residence in the past three years. Veterans and buyers in certain targeted areas may be exempt from this rule.
- At least one buyer must complete an approved homebuyer education course before closing. Some military and veteran exemptions apply.
